Scrubber that can switch between open- and closed-loop modes depending on local discharge regulations.

Most common newbuild scrubber type, valued for operational flexibility. Open-loop in deep ocean; closed-loop when transiting open-loop-restricted areas (US territorial waters, China, Singapore, etc.). Cost ~30% higher than open-only; payback hinges on price spread between VLSFO and HSFO.
